跨链互操作三大挑战:信任、兼容与安全

跨链互操作的三重难题:信任、兼容与安全在实践中的博弈

在多链并存的加密货币生态中,资产跨链转移、跨链合约调用以及跨链资产组合成为现实需求。越发多样化的链条带来了机遇,也暴露出系统性的技术与治理难题。本文从实际场景出发,剖析跨链互操作面临的三大挑战——信任、兼容与安全,并结合钱包、交易所、DeFi 与 NFT 用例,讨论应对策略与潜在风险。

现实场景:为何跨链不可回避

– 去中心化交易所(DEX)需要多个链上的流动性来实现最优价格发现与跨资产兑换。
– NFT 项目希望在不同链上扩展市场,降低铸造成本或借助某条链的特性(如隐私或低手续费)。
– 跨链借贷和衍生品协议需要在多个资产间配置抵押物,从而提高资本效率。

这些场景都要求在链与链之间转移价值或信息,因此跨链方案是基础设施。但实际运作时,开发者与用户会面临三个相互交织的挑战。

挑战一:信任模型的重新设计

传统区块链的安全性来自于其一致性的去中心化共识。跨链操作则需要在两个或多个独立的共识域之间建立信任桥梁,常见方式包括:

– 中继与轻客户端:目标链通过验证源链的区块头或交易证明来确认跨链事件。理论上最去信任,但实现和维护成本高,轻客户端同步、状态证明与分叉处理复杂。
– 可信第三方/中介(trusted relays):使用一个或多个中心化实体搬运跨链信息,延迟低、实现简单,但引入单点或有限点信任风险。
– 多签验证与阈值签名:通过一组验证者签名确认,能够在一定程度上减少单点失败,但需解决验证者选取、激励与作恶惩罚机制。
– 证明与债务凭证(比如闪电网络式的偿付承诺):基于经济激励与惩罚来保证诚实行为,但对设计参数敏感。

信任不足会导致资产被锁定、桥被盗或跨链事件回滚。设计跨链协议时,必须在安全性、成本与用户体验间做权衡,并对信任边界进行明确定义与披露。

挑战二:跨链兼容的技术鸿沟

不同链在交易模型、合约语言、状态表达、事件证明方式上存在本质差异:

– 虚拟机差异:EVM 链通过日志与事件可以较为容易地做事件证明,但基于 UTXO 的链或基于账本的私链在状态语义上不同,直接互操作需要中间层翻译。
– 状态证明与可验证性:有些链支持轻客户端验证或默克尔证明,有些链则不便于生成可验证的跨链证据。
– 账户模型与签名方案:跨链签名聚合或多重签名在不同曲线、不同地址格式的链间难以互通。
– 时间与最终性:一些链(如以太坊)最终性弱,存在回滚风险;而 PoS 一些实现有较快最终性约束,跨链需考虑确认深度与补偿机制。

应对兼容性鸿沟的通常做法包含引入跨链消息层(message bus)、中间链(hub)或构建通用标准(如 IBC 在 Cosmos 生态的尝试)。但每种方案都带来复杂性:中间链成为新的攻击面,通用标准需要大量链方配合。

挑战三:跨链安全的多维攻防

跨链系统的攻击面远大于单链应用,常见威胁有:

– 桥合约被利用:锁定-发行模型若合约逻辑或签名机制漏洞被利用,会导致铸造出假资产或无法赎回原资产。
– 验证者或中继被攻破/串通:多签验证组若多数失守,资产安全无保障。
– 前端与中间层篡改:用户看到的状态可能被中间层伪造,导致误操作。
– 重放攻击与跨链重入:在不同链上重复提交相同证明或在状态同步过程中触发未预期的回调。
– 经济攻击:攻击者通过操纵跨链价格预言机,从而在跨链借贷中触发清算。

因此,跨链安全不仅是智能合约审计的问题,还涉及验证者治理、安全激励、监控系统及应急恢复(如多方签撤销、桥应急熔断开关)。值得注意的是,许多历史上的桥被盗事件并不是单点合约漏洞,而是系统性信任与治理缺陷的体现。

钱包与交易平台的实践差异

– 钱包:非托管钱包通常倾向于避免直接承担跨链信任,采用连接到受信任的桥或引导用户使用跨链兑换服务;而一些钱包集成了中间桥服务以提升用户体验,但也因此承担更多信任与合规风险。
– 交易所/托管平台:中心化交易所可以通过内部账簿进行跨链“内转”以规避链上桥的风险,但这把信任完全转移给交易所。平台需要做到对热钱包冷钱包、内部清算与外部桥接的严格隔离与审计。
– 去中心化跨链服务(如跨链 DEX、跨链路由器):这些服务通常依赖流动性协议或借贷池来实现无桥跨链(例如通过借贷空头对冲),但复杂性和潜在环节多,安全与清算风险更高。

DeFi 与 NFT 的跨链案例解析

– 跨链借贷:项目会将某链作为抵押,借出另一链资产。关键问题在于抵押资产的可追回性与价格预言机跨链一致性。实践中会采用缓冲时间、抵押率差异和跨链清算代理以降低风险。
– NFT 跨链流通:常见做法是原链锁定、目标链铸造代表物(wrapped NFT)。需要保证元数据不可篡改及所有权回溯路径透明,同时制定冗余证明链路(例如记录在多个观察者节点)以防单一桥伪证。
– 跨链 AMM:跨链流动性池通过路由器将不同链上的池子连接,实现价格链间同步。此类系统对延迟与最终性高度敏感,容易遭受时间差套利攻击。

风险对收益的平衡与监管影响

跨链技术带来资本效率和用户体验的显著提升,但也放大了系统性风险。项目方与用户需在以下点权衡:

– 安全 vs 速度:更去信任的方案通常更慢、更复杂。
– 成本 vs 去中心化:中心化桥便宜,但集中化风险大。
– 可组合性 vs 隔离:跨链可组合性提高创新速度,但故障传播风险随之增长。

监管方面,跨链交易模糊了监管管辖边界:资产在链间流动可能规避单一司法权的监控,促使监管机构关注跨链服务提供者的合规身份、反洗钱程序以及对用户资产托管的审查。合规压力可能推动更多桥转托管化或要求验证者进行 KYC。

实践建议与未来趋势(技术层面)

– 多层防护:引入链上审计、离线监控与崩溃应对流程(如桥熔断器、多签回退计划)。
– 标准化努力:支持通用消息格式与证明机制的标准(例如更广泛的轻客户端接口)有助于降低兼容性成本。
– 可验证中继:发展基于零知识证明的跨链证明,能够压缩证明大小并降低轻客户端成本,从而增强去信任跨链的实用性。
– 分布式验证者经济学:设计合理的激励与惩罚机制,降低验证者串通的可能性,同时确保良好的可扩展性。
– 组合式容错:采用多路径跨链(多个独立桥并行验证)作为冗余,提高攻防成本。

跨链互操作并非单一技术可以解决的课题,而是技术、治理与经济激励共同作用的系统工程。理解信任边界、兼容代价与安全攻防,是设计与使用跨链系统时不可回避的基本功。对于技术爱好者来说,审视每一种跨链方案的信任模型与应急机制,比单纯追求低手续费与高速度更为重要。

© 版权声明
THE END
喜欢就支持一下吧
分享
评论 抢沙发

请登录后发表评论

    暂无评论内容